MP's minerals to be processed in state itself
Indore, Oct 25 (UNI) Madhya Pradesh Chief Minister Shivraj Singh Chouhan today spoke of a resolve to process the state's minerals in the state itself.
''A chain of industry will be started based on material found in Madhya Pradesh. Utilisation of our abundant forests, water and mineral wealth will lead to employment opportunities,'' he said while addressing the foundation stone-laying ceremony of a Rs 500-crore, 120-acre Diamond (cutting and polishing) Park at nearby Rau Industrial Area.
While pointing out that diamonds were being obtained in Chhatarpur district's Baksaha block besides Panna district, state Commerce and Industry Minister Jayant Malaiya claimed that the Park would be of international standard.
''It will also have a training centre with capacity to train about 2,000 youth, a Jewellery Mall and International Convention Centre,'' said Industrial Centre Development Corporation Managing Director and Collector Vivek Agrawal.
